Key Factors to Consider Before Buying Party Dresses
Shopping for a party dress is a fun thing to do, yet it is overwhelming at the same time when there are numerous options. Having a reduced number of options implies focusing on a handful of critical factors.
The best things to remember are the following:
- Occasion: The right party dress you will wear at a cocktail party will not be the same as what you will wear in a wedding party.
- Body Shape: Choose the cuts and styles that would suit your body shape.
- Fabric: The satin, silk, sequins and chiffon are the key fashion trends in the UK.
- Color: Be bold with jewellery colour or be conservative with neutral colors such as black, navy or champagne.
- Budget: Designer designs are beautiful, yet there are also numerous suitable best dresses for parties that have a very low price.
- Weather: You want to consider the season, so velvet suits in winter and chiffon suits in summer.
All these make your party dresses not only look beautiful but also be comfortable when you wear them.

Style Tips to Elevate Your Party Look
It is one thing to own those stylish party dresses but to wear them properly is the key. A fashionable dress does not only improve your appearance; it also improves your self-esteem.
The following are some of the clever styling tips:
- Details are important: Wear your fancy party dresses with accessories like a pair of statement earrings or a clutch to make them look glamorous.
- Shoe selection: Heels make one look fancy and smooth, and flats make one look stylish but comfortable.
- Layering hacks: When it gets colder in the season, add a customized blazer or faux fur jacket.
- Balance: Do not have heavy embellishments on your dress; keep jewellery to a minimum.
- Be trendy and party: UK parties have a reputation of trying bold fashion, so there is no need to be afraid of trying bright colors or metallics.
